How do i ensure that AGP 4X is enabled?


I was just wondering is there any way of finding out or ensuring that my Video Card is running @ 4X?

I have an epox 8kha+, with AGP 4X selected in the BIOS but when i run WCPUid it says that AGP 2.0 is disabled. However i've seen other people with this enabled on their Epox 8KHa+, so i'm worried i might be only running in AGP 1X or something.

I have a GeForce 3 Ti 200.
